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
55 OLD CHURCH ROAD Detached £350,000 13 Feb 2024
67 OLD CHURCH ROAD Detached £125,000 8 May 2002
84 OLD CHURCH ROAD Terraced £224,000 22 Nov 2019
86 OLD CHURCH ROAD Terraced £66,000 18 Jul 1997
90 OLD CHURCH ROAD Terraced £91,000 1 Mar 2001
92 OLD CHURCH ROAD Semi-Detached £310,000 27 Sep 2019
96 OLD CHURCH ROAD Detached £395,000 4 Sep 2020
98 OLD CHURCH ROAD Detached £320,000 23 Sep 2016
ELDON HOUSE, 80 OLD CHURCH ROAD Terraced £185,000 31 Jul 2003